The AROS Archives(anonymous IP:,342) 


   o Audio (94)
   o Datatype (15)
   o Demo (46)
   o Development (243)
   o Document (61)
   o Driver (19)
   o Emulation (60)
   o Game (519)
   o Graphics (219)
   o Library (22)
   o Network (60)
   o Office (21)
   o Utility (245)
   o Video (18)

Total files: 1642

Full index file
Recent index file

Part of aros exec
 Readme for:  Development » Misc »


Description: Automatic version generator, fully configurable.
Download:       (TIPS: Use the right click menu if your browser takes you back here all the time)
Size: 13kb
Version: 3.5
Date: 09 May 09
Author: Robin Cloutman, AROS port by submitter
Submitter: Matthias Rustler
Email: mrustler/gmx de
Category: development/misc
License: Other
Distribute: yes
FileID: 576
Comments: 0
Snapshots: 0
Videos: 0
Downloads: 105  (Current version)
105  (Accumulated)
Votes: 0 (0/0)  (30 days/7 days)

[Show comments] [Show snapshots] [Show videos] [Show content] [Replace file] 
AROS port of Robin's bumprev utility.
Installation: copy "bump" somewhere to the search path and the
bump-#? files to S:

Origninal Readme

This can easily replace C='s bumprev.

· User defined output formats. (Unlike bumprev)
· Remembers both version and revision. (Unlike bumprev)
· Easy to use. (Unlike bumprev)
· Output almost identical to bumprev. (Unlike... erm...)
· Includes output for C, C++, ARexx, Asm.
· Includes full source. (gcc version egcs-2.90.27 980315 (egcs-1.0.2 release))
· Has installer.
· 68000-68060 versions.

  Although I have included the source code, I reserve full rights to it.
  If you wish to add/change anything, then do it through me - I don't want
  lots of versions hanging around...


 NAME/A - the base name to use, will create "{NAME}_rev.ver" containing
 CODE/M - which code module(s) to use.
 VERSION/S - bump the version (and set revision to 0).
 SETVERSION/K/N - set the version to this.
 NO=NOREVISION/S - don't bump the revision. (Useful for code generation only)
 SETREVISION/K/N - set the revision to this.
 QUIET/S - don't output any information for the user.

Code Generation:
  All code generation files must reside in "S:" or the location pointed to by
the "BUMPCODE" enviroment variable.
  Each file has the name "bump-*", with the * replaced by the text in each
CODE/M option.
  Every line in the file starting with "##" can be -
  · "## inform ..." Tell the user something.
  · "## suffix ..." Close the current output file, and open another with the
name "{NAME}_rev.{suffix}".
  · "## filename ..." Close the current output file, and open another with this
  · "## ..." anything else is a comment.
  Replaced Symbols:
  · "%n" is the name.
  · "%v" is the version.
  · "%r" is the revision.
  · "%d" is the current date.
  · "%t" is the current time.
  · "%V" is the version of bump used (ie. bump 3.1).
  · "%l?" is the length of the second symbol (ie. "%ld" is replaced by "8")
  (see Bump-test)
  NOTE: You can create more than one output file by using ##suffix and
##filename more than once!

· 1.0 - First effort.
· 1.1 - Added rexx code.
· 1.2 - Added locale support. (REMOVED)
· 1.3 - Minor bug fixed...
· 1.4 - Recompiled with "gcc version egcs-2.90.27 980315 (egcs-1.0.2 release)"
1.5 - Automatically generate required code, only need switch first time.
· 2.0 - Made resident, otherwise no change.
· 2.1 - Rewrote to make it easier to expand...
· 3.0 - Changed template.
        Made code output user-defined.
        Removed locale support.
        Removed automatic code generation.
· 3.1 - Improved code parsing, user info and multiple files allowed.
· 3.2 - Now searches "PROGDIR:", "S:", and $BUMPCODE for code.
· 3.3 - Also searches {NAME} dir.
· 3.4 - Code cleanup and new ## command (filename).
· 3.5 - Recompiled with "gcc version egcs-2.91.66 19990314 (egcs-1.1.2
        First Aminet release.

Copyright © 2005 - 2024 The AROS Archives All Rights Reserved